I don't know what "pack and ship" mean, but my Dad and I had a great time at Boar Creek Ranch about a couple hours southeast of Dallas. The cabins were nice and they fed us great breakfasts and dinners. Very hospitable folks.

They have various blinds with timed feeders strategically and safely situated throughout for mostly night time hunts. Each blind has a battery-powered red light aimed at the feeder. I just had a cheap scope and could see fine at night, but you can use night vision if you have it. They also have blinds set up for bowhunting - one family that was there with us bowhunted. For an extra $40 the guides will even butcher your pig.
